*S&P 500 RESUMES UPTREND AFTER TRIMMING GAINS ON REPORT OF RUSSIAN ROCKETS IN POLAND $SPY
Two stray Russian rockets landed and killed two people in the NATO state of Poland, Associated Press reported, citing an unnamed U.S. intelligence official. The Polish government called an urgent meeting of the national security committee.
Russia's defence ministry denied its missiles had hit Polish territory, calling the reports "a deliberate provocation aimed at escalating the situation". The news had briefly stoked geopolitical tensions, briefly lifting demand for safe-haven Treasuries and the dollar, but the safe-haven move faded and stocks resumed their rally amid signs that inflation is cooling.rose 0.2% in October, well below the 0.4% rise expected, reinforcing “the notion that peak prices are behind us,” Stifel said in a note, following data last week showing slowing consumer prices.
